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08 85320350 7769754 31488216
3859 68473884003
3859 68473884003
43942482 63 3917
All about undefined
Interested in learning more?
3859 68473884003
43942482 63 3917
See more
14 9473845
41959735 152 9258
See more
2005 7135303940 63147077205
3896 0041639990 687
See more